How To Unblur Tinder Matches

The Hard Way (Like All The Others Tell You)

Most of the Tinder hacks on the web showing you how to unblur the image of one of your matches requires you to right-click on one of the blurred images in Google Chrome and click “Inspect”.

Doing so will bring up a console that allows you to see the code behind the creation of the webpage.

As you scroll across items in the webpage Elements Inspection contents, you’ll see it highlight various parts of the webpage. We want to find the highlighted area, noted in the image above, that references the actual picture we want to remove the blur from.

The highlight will look like this.

Next, you want to find the line that reads:



<div class=”Bdrs(8px) Bgz(cv) Bgp(c) Ov(h) StretchedBox Ir(p) Cnt($blank)::a StretchedBox::a Bg($inherit)::a Scale(1.3)::a Scale(1.2)::a–s Blur(12px)::a” style=”background-image: url(“https://preview.gotinder.com/randomstringofnumbers.jpg”); background-position: 50% 0%; background-size: auto 100.952%;”></div>

The line we want to edit is: a–s Blur(12px)

Change the Blur(12px) to Blur(0px) and suddenly the image isn’t nearly as blurry anymore! Tinder uses some sort of super compressed thumbnail image of the original, so it isn’t perfect quality, but it is good enough to see what the person look like and see if upgrading to Tinder Gold might be worth it to swipe on them and invite them on a date (preferably not to the movies)! The Easy Hack To Unblur Tinder Matches In Bulk Without Buying Gold

Here’s how we’re going to bulk unblur Tinder images on your “Likes You” page without paying for Tinder Gold.

Much like the prior step, you’re going to right-click somewhere on the web page using Google Chrome and click “Inspect” to bring up the Element Inspection box. This time, look at the top of the box to find the “Console” tab and click it.

Click the highlighted text: Console

This will allow us to run a command on the page.

Clicking the Console tab will bring up a box that looks like this.

Now we’re going to copy and paste in the following command:

document.body.innerHTML = document.body.innerHTML.replace(/(12px)/g,"(0px)")

It’ll look like this!

How does this command work? We know that each image Tinder blurs uses blur pixelization of 12px. So each time you see a Tinder match blurred out in the Elements Inspection box, you’ll note it does so with the code: a–s Blur(12px). This command simply goes through the code on the page and looks for each reference of “12px” and changes it to “0px”.

After you copy and paste the snippet of code into the console…

document.body.innerHTML = document.body.innerHTML.replace(/(12px)/g,"(0px)")

…simply hit enter and the entire page will update with all of the Tinder images no longer being as blurred. This basically does the hard method explained above in one simple step. So now, instead of going through and unblurring Tinder images one by one, this method unblurs all your matches in one quick command.

Again, because Tinder uses a compressed version of a small thumbnail and then upsizes it before blurring, we have to use a separate Tinder hack to get a fully un-pixelized version of people you haven’t matched with yet on Tinder; however, the image should be clear enough to determine if they are a decent match to investigate further.
